Skip to main content

TOS 5.1 / TOS 6.0 Più directory public / homes non visualizzate

Versioni applicabili

  • TOS 5.1.x
  • TOS 6.0.x

Descrizione del problema

Quando il sistema ha più volumi con directory public o homes, l'interfaccia web non può visualizzare normalmente queste directory, impedendo di operare direttamente dall'interfaccia.

Spiegazione della causa

Limitazione del meccanismo di visualizzazione delle directory di TOS 5.1 / 6.0: il sistema riconosce solo una singola directory public o homes per impostazione predefinita; quando più volumi hanno contemporaneamente questo tipo di directory di sistema, vengono nascoste automaticamente nelle cartelle condivise e nella gestione file, e non possono essere sfogliate o modificate direttamente.

Soluzione 1: Rinominare la directory tramite 【Pianificazione attività】 (applicabile a TOS 5.1 / 6.0)

Eseguire la rinominazione tramite le attività di sistema, quindi ripristinare la visualizzazione nelle cartelle condivise, procedere come segue:

  1. Accedere all'interfaccia web di TOS, aprire il Pannello di controllo.
  2. Scorrere verso il basso e trovare Impostazioni generali → Pianificazione attività.
  3. Fare clic su Crea → Piano personalizzato, completare le impostazioni di base seguendo la procedura guidata (non è necessario selezionare opzioni aggiuntive).
  4. In Script comando personalizzato, inserire il comando di rinominazione, esempio:
    mv /Volume3/public /Volume3/public_bak
    • Sostituire Volume3 con il nome effettivo del volume
    • Sostituire public con public_bak
  5. Salvare l'attività, fare clic su Esegui per eseguire la rinominazione immediatamente.
  6. Tornare a Pannello di controllo → Cartelle condivise.
  7. Fare clic su Impostazioni avanzate nell'angolo in alto a destra, selezionare il volume appena operato e eseguire Ripristina cartelle condivise.
  8. Al termine del ripristino, tornare alle cartelle condivise o alla gestione file per visualizzare normalmente la directory rinominata.

Nota: Dopo la rinominazione, il sistema non la riconosce più come "directory di sistema public o homes", quindi può essere visualizzata normalmente.

Soluzione 2: Operare tramite terminale SSH (applicabile a TOS 5.1 / 6.0)

TOS 6.0: È possibile utilizzare direttamente il terminale integrato

  1. Pannello di controllo → Servizi terminale, selezionare Abilita SSH, porta predefinita 9222.

  2. Desktop → Tutte le applicazioni → Terminale, accedere direttamente alla riga di comando.

  3. Esempi di operazioni comuni:

    # Accedere alla directory radice del Volume
    cd /volume3
    # Visualizzare i file
    ls
    # Rinominare (stesso effetto della soluzione 1)
    mv /public /public_bak
  4. Dopo aver completato le operazioni, riavviare il dispositivo. Se non viene visualizzato normalmente, è possibile utilizzare la funzione di ripristino avanzato delle cartelle condivise.

TOS 5.1: Senza terminale integrato, sono necessari strumenti SSH esterni per la connessione remota

  1. Pannello di controllo → Servizi di rete → Terminale e SNMP, abilitare SSH (porta 9222).

  2. Utilizzare strumenti come PuTTY / Xshell / FinalShell sul computer per connettersi, per la configurazione dettagliata consultare la documentazione ufficiale:

https://forum.terra-master.com/cn/viewtopic.php?t=1511

  1. Dopo l'accesso, eseguire lo stesso comando mv di cui sopra, e riavviare il dispositivo dopo aver completato l'operazione.